Abstract
⺠The sorption of sulfadiazine (SDZ) was studied in four tropical soil-water systems. ⺠The low values of the KF indicate that SDZ is highly mobile in the evaluated soils. ⺠The desorption values were higher than those obtained for adsorption of SDZ. ⺠A small positive hysteresis was observed with all soils under study. ⺠The main mechanism of the sorption of SDZ is partitioning to organic matter.
